    Managing personal finances effectively requires a clear understanding of your financial health, and one of the key metrics used to evaluate this is the debt to income ratio. Whether you’re applying for a mortgage, looking to refinance, or simply aiming to improve your financial well-being, understanding your DTI is essential.

    What is the Debt-to-Income Ratio?

    The Debt-to-Income Ratio is a percentage that compares your monthly debt payments to your gross monthly income (income before taxes and deductions). It helps lenders assess your ability to manage monthly payments and repay debts. To calculate your DTI, divide your total monthly debt obligations by your gross monthly income and multiply by 100.

    DTI Formula:

    DTI = (Total Monthly Debt Payments / Gross Monthly Income) × 100

    For example, if your monthly debts (credit card, car loan, student loans, mortgage, etc.) total ₹50,000 and your gross monthly income is ₹1,50,000, your DTI would be:

    (50,000 / 1,50,000) × 100 = 33.3%

    Why is DTI Important?

    Lenders use the DTI ratio to determine whether you can handle more debt. A lower DTI suggests that you have a good balance between debt and income, making you a less risky borrower. A higher DTI, on the other hand, may indicate that you’re overextended financially.

    • Ideal DTI: Most lenders prefer a DTI of 36% or lower.
    • Acceptable DTI: Up to 43% may still qualify for some loans, especially mortgages.
    • High DTI: Over 50% may lead to loan denial or high interest rates.

    Components of DTI

    1. Front-End Ratio: Also known as the housing ratio, this considers only housing-related expenses like rent or mortgage payments, property taxes, and insurance.
    2. Back-End Ratio: This includes all recurring monthly debts, such as credit cards, loans, and other obligations.

    Lenders often focus on the back-end ratio because it provides a comprehensive picture of your financial commitments.

    How to Improve Your DTI

    If your DTI is too high, consider the following strategies:

    • Pay Down Existing Debt: Focus on high-interest debts first. Reducing balances lowers your monthly payments.
    • Avoid New Debt: Delay taking on new loans or credit cards.
    • Increase Your Income: Take on a side job, freelance work, or negotiate a raise to improve your income side of the equation.
    • Create a Budget: Track your spending and cut unnecessary expenses to free up funds for debt repayment.

    Final Thoughts

    Your Debt-to-Income Ratio is more than just a number—it’s a snapshot of your financial health and borrowing capacity. Maintaining a healthy DTI not only improves your chances of loan approval but also ensures better financial stability. Regularly monitoring your DTI and taking proactive steps to manage debt can help you achieve long-term financial goals and reduce money-related stress.
